For years, Israel Adesanya and Jon Jones have not gotten along. On several occasions, there has been talk of a potential fight between the two men. Nonetheless, that conversation ended when Jones announced his move up to heavyweight.
The clash between ‘Izzy’ and ‘Bones’ will therefore probably never take place. A few weeks ago, Jon Jones even called Israel Adesanya the most entertaining fighter in the UFC right now. Words that did not fail to react to the main interested party.
“For me, evolution is something you have to go through as a human being,” Israel Adesanya said on the “Impaulsive” podcast. “As a man, it’s mostly maturity. When I got to the UFC… I feel like it’s up to him to admit it, but I feel like he was a fan, he was kind of like ‘Ugh, there there’s another one coming and shining’. But there’s enough room for both of us to shine. »
“We can be in our own ways and be great. I’ve been a fan of Jon since UFC 94 when he fought Stephan Bonnar. I saw what he did in that fight… But yeah. True recognizes true, I’ll put it like that. »
In his heavyweight debut at UFC 285, Jon Jones submitted Ciryl Gane in the 1st round, capturing the belt. Now that he is champion, the American is looking to defend his title. Israel Adesanya may have a big challenge ahead of him at UFC 293…
